Why does my KitchenAid ice taste bad or smell?
Old filters and freezer odors are common causes. Replacing the filter and cleaning the ice bin usually improves taste and smell.
My KitchenAid ice output is low - what can be wrong?
Slow ice production is often linked to warmer freezer temps, restricted water flow, or a partially blocked filter. Door seal leaks can also warm the freezer.
My KitchenAid ice maker fill tube is frozen - what causes this?
If the valve seeps water after the fill, it can freeze and block the tube. Checking inlet valve operation and freezer temp helps prevent repeats.
My KitchenAid ice maker stopped making ice - what usually causes this?
Check that the freezer is cold enough and the water line is on. If water never fills the mold, the inlet valve or fill tube may need service.
Why are my KitchenAid ice cubes small or hollow?
If cubes look hollow, the mold often isn't filling completely. Check the filter and water line; a failing inlet valve can also cause underfilling.
